LPG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review
198 of the 6,310 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dorian LPG (LPG)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$689M — up 3.8% from $664M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 34 funds opened new LPG posit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 71 added to existing stakes and 61 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Pacer Advisors, adding an estimated $7.52M. The largest seller was Kensico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$10.5M sold.
